On 10/04/2013 03:55 PM, Mike Galbraith wrote:
On Fri, 2013-10-04 at 13:28 +0200, Sebastian Andrzej Siewior wrote:
On 10/04/2013 01:16 PM, Mike Galbraith wrote:
Manfred's race fix also kills loop, and thereby the -rt livelock, so the
only question is does -rt want to use his completion wakeup scheme, and
does it want to do something about spin_unlock_wait() unconditionally
grabbing/releasing every lock in the array.
So his patches went into v3.11 or so right? So all -RT released post
this point will have it fixed right?
Most fixes have gone into master.  There's still at least one in the
pipe, ipc/sem.c: synchronize semop and semctl with IPC_RMID, and I
_think_ there's still one open issue.

<quoting Manfred>
And now new:
1) ipc/namespace.c:
      free_ipcs() still assumes the "old style" free calls:
      rcu_lock and ipc_lock dropped within the callback.

      freeary() was converted - but free_ipcs was not updated.

      Thus:
      Closing a namespace with sem arrays and threads that are waiting
on
the array with semtimedop() and bad timing can deadlock the semtimedop
thread.
      (i.e.: spin_lock() waiting forever).
</quoting Manfred>
That one was a false alarm, i.e. everything is fixed in -mm.
